Glenwood Park is a park in Oklahoma, at a recorded 415 m. Mount Pinchot stands 750 m to the northeast, 13 miles off. The nearest named place is Great Plains State Park, a park 5.0 miles away. Wichita Mountains Byway passes 11 miles off.
